Business Development Manager – HVAC
Pay: $90,000–$120,000 per year (based on experience)
Schedule: Full-time, Monday–Friday/Remote
Travel: 25%–40% (preferred)
Industry: Thermal solutions/Cooling and Air-Moving Products
Mandarin skills a plus but not required

Job Description
In this role candidate will sell EC fans and air-moving solutions to HVACR OEMs, system integrators, and equipment manufacturers. Meet with customer engineering and sourcing teams to present products, gather requirements, and drive design-ins from concept through mass production. Work closely with Asia-based R&D, engineering, and manufacturing teams to manage projects, schedules, samples, and builds.
